Federal OSHA recorded a severe workplace injury at Cavender Cadillac of Lubbock, 1210 19th Street, LUBBOCK, TEXAS 79401 on , Chemical burns and corrosions, unspecified, affecting the leg(s), unspecified.

An employee was handling wheel acid when it spilled onto her right leg and soaked through her clothing. The employee was hospitalized due to chemical burns to her leg.
